About this topic
Journey to work shows where employed residents of Northam (S) travel for work. It helps explain how strongly the area functions as a residential base versus a self-contained employment centre.
These flow patterns can inform transport advocacy, local jobs policy, and investment priorities by showing which external labour markets matter most to residents.
Key insight
32.6% of employed residents living in Northam (S) worked outside Northam (S) in 2021. No Fixed Address (WA) was the largest external destination.

Data table
Where Northam (S) residents work table
Download the ranked local and external flow counts behind the chart.
| Area | Count |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Northam | 3,068 | 67.4% |
| No Fixed Address (WA) | 234 | 5.1% |
| Swan | 177 | 3.9% |
| Mundaring | 175 | 3.8% |
| Perth | 85 | 1.9% |
| York | 77 | 1.7% |
| Belmont | 75 | 1.6% |
| East Pilbara | 57 | 1.3% |
| Toodyay | 50 | 1.1% |
| Other LGAs | 553 | 12.2% |
